1.给窗口标题设置图标,构造函数中添加
QIcon icon(":/new/prefix1/pic/lock16.png");
setWindowIcon(icon);
2.给exe设置图标:
方式一:
①在rc目录(与exe同一目录)下新建一个joke.rc;
②用记事本打开粘贴如下文本
IDI_ICON1 ICON DISCARDABLE "smile.ico"
③在pro文件中加入:
RC_FILE = rc/joke.rc
④执行qmake,然后构建就可以了。
方式2:
①图片在线生成.ico文件
(图片另存为BMP图片,再显示扩展名,更改为ico)
②在pro文件中加入:
RC_ICONS = icon.ico
③执行qmake,然后构建就可以了。
**********************************************************************************************
软件自己的漏洞:改图标似乎没用
①打开Makefile.Release 文件,查找 .ico 看文件怎写的
②手动改一下名字
③检查文件中其他标红地方,改正!
参考链接https://blog.csdn.net/xiezhongyuan07/article/details/79320523